The Heart of the Beast: Movement and Functionality
The Breitling Cockpit B50 VB5010A4/BD41/444X/A20D.1 is powered by a Breitling Caliber B50, a sophisticated SuperQuartz™ movement. This thermocompensated quartz movement offers exceptional accuracy, far surpassing that of a standard quartz movement. The thermocompensation ensures consistent timekeeping across a wide range of temperatures, a crucial factor for reliable performance in varying environments. The inclusion of this advanced movement is a testament to Breitling's commitment to innovation and precision.
Beyond its superior accuracy, the B50 movement offers a comprehensive array of functions. The chronograph function, a staple of Breitling watches, allows for precise time measurement. The user-friendly interface, controlled via the pushers and crown, makes navigating these functions simple and intuitive. The watch also incorporates a range of practical features, including a second time zone display, a perpetual calendar, and an alarm function. These features enhance the watch's versatility, making it suitable for a variety of situations, from everyday wear to demanding professional contexts.
